Quick provenance primer for the Harlowe Search relevance work: every tuning experiment you run gets baked into a signed build artifact, so we can always trace which weight file shipped where. Don't hand-edit the ranking config on staging — it breaks the attestation chain and the Velmora dashboard will flag your run as untrusted. Instead, commit changes and let the pipeline stamp them. Each stamped artifact carries the identifier shown below.

session token of bawep-yadup = htk21_528abd376e3c5a4ec24a1

Subject: Guest Wi-Fi desk — night shift heads up

Hi all, quick note from the front desk at Pellbright House. We've set up a small guest Wi-Fi station at reception so late visitors can get themselves online without hunting us down. If someone asks after hours, point them to the tablet on the left of the desk and they can self-register. The drawer underneath has spare cables and the laminated instructions. The drawer keypad is new, so heads up — the code you need is below.

door code, kawip-bagap: bdg-HQEWH-4

### Account Recovery — Catalogue Import (Lintwood)

Quick one for review: when the Lintwood catalogue import wipes a patron's session table, the recovery flow re-seeds accounts from the nightly snapshot. Check that the importer skips locked accounts — last time it didn't. To rerun recovery against staging you'll need the vault passphrase, which is appended just below.

recovery phrase for yafof-tajof: julmir-kelax-julvan-holath-belvan-holir-ralael-ralvan-ralath-julvan-silmir-istmir-kaswyn-ulamir